What was Queen Victoria's relationship with her parents?
Victoria's father, Edward, Duke of Kent, died when she was only eight months old, leaving many debts. The Duchess brought Victoria up at Kensington Palace and, under the influence of the ambitious Sir John Conroy, instituted the "Kensington System", whereby the child was not allowed to be alone at any time. She even had to hold somebody's hand when she went downstairs, right up until the time she was eighteen. Victoria's only friend was her governess, Baroness Lehzen, who supported the princess in every way possible.
Victoria was mentally abused by Conroy, with her mother's connivance, especially as she approached her majority. Conroy had counted on her becoming Queen before she reached eighteen and tried to force her to sign a paper appointing him as her Private Secretary. Although under appalling pressure, Victoria refused. When she became Queen a month after her eighteenth birthday, she dismissed Conroy from her household although he continued to exert an unhealthy influence over the Duchess. From the day of Victoria's accession, there was a rift between her and the Duchess. For the next two years, relations between mother and daughter were extremely strained, amply demonstrated by the Lady Flora Hastings scandal, when the Duchess supported the maligned Lady Flora and the Queen believed her to be pregnant by Conroy.
One of Victoria's first acts as Queen was to pay all her father's debts.
Eventually, under the influence of the Duke of Wellington, Conroy left the Duchess, and, in time, with the help of Prince Albert, mother and daughter became reconciled. Victoria was always aware that her mother had only had her daughter's best interests at heart, but that she had been left without a husband to help guide her, and so, fallen prey to Conroy. Wellington is quoted as "supposing" that the Duchess and Conroy were lovers. However, after the reconciliation, mother and daughter realised how very much they loved each other. When the Duchess died in March 1861, eight months before Prince Albert, Victoria was completely bereft and Albert feared for her sanity in the violence of her grief.

Was JFK with his wife when he was killed?
Yes, she was. Jacqueline Kennedy was sitting in the limousine next to her husband at the time that he was shot. She held his body as the limousine sped to the hospital and was with him when he was pronounced dead.

What is Barack Obama's plan for RFID Cards?
He doesn't have one. The RFID question is based on an internet myth about computer chips being secretly implanted in Americans as part of the health care law. But the health care law has nothing in it about computer chips or secretly tracking citizens. These statements were made by President Obama's political opponents, who were trying to scare voters so that they would not want the health care law to pass. Would Gatorade cause cancer for people?
No, it would not. Gatorade is a sports drink, used to rehydrate athletes who have lost a lot of water through perspiring. It provides vitamins and is supposed to restore energy. But despite rumors about what ingredients it contains (and the alleged danger of at least one of its ingredients), there are no scientific tests that have ever linked Gatorade to cancer. On the other hand, it is a sweet drink and could lead to obesity; it also is vitamin-enriched and if you drink too much of it, you might ingest too high a dose of certain vitamins, which could temporarily give you headaches or blurred vision.

Gavrilo Princip was connected to a secret organization in Serbia called the Black Hand (or "Unification or Death") which wanted all the lands populated by South Slavs to be under one government. Most of these places, aside from Serbia, were part of Austria-Hungary before World War I. The Black Hand apparently recruited a number of Bosnian students, including Gavrilo Princip, to assassinate Franz Ferdinand, and provided them with weapons and support. The Archduke was the heir to the Austrian throne and also an important reformer in the Habsburg government who wanted to reorganize the empire to give its Slav subjects more say. Serbia absolutely did not want this to happen, because that would mean that it would be less of an influence on Slavic nationalists in Austria-Hungary.
Franz Ferdinand was inspecting the Austrian army in Sarajevo on an important Serbian holiday, Vidovdan, when he was assassinated. Princip's group had five chances to kill him along his route (they were spread out along it) and they screwed up all five times, although one of them wounded a bunch of people with a bomb. Franz Ferdinand continued to the town hall where there was going to be a reception, but afterwards decided to visit some of the victims of the bombing in a hospital instead of leaving the city as he had planned. Princip was in a shop getting a sandwich when he saw the Archduke's car coming by (it had taken a wrong turn). So he shot him and attempted to shoot the governor of Bosnia but got the Archduke's wife instead.
So yes, there was a conspiracy, but it was a nationalist conspiracy supported by Serbia and didn't involve anyone in Austria-Hungary. The driver was definitely not involved (in fact, he was rewarded by the last emperor Charles I). He was a Czech named Leopold Lojka and he had no reason to want Franz Ferdinand dead (he certainly didn't seem to be a nationalist, but even if he had been, Czech nationalists rather liked Franz Ferdinand at that point), and it's reasonable to think that he just took a wrong turn because he hadn't gotten the change in plans. The Black Hand and other Serbian nationalists wanted to kill Franz Ferdinand purely because of his political beliefs and his status as the heir apparent -- nobody had any idea it would start World War I.
Which shot did what in the the Kennedy assassination?
Oswald's first bullet missed and spanged off the asphalt, drawing Connally's attention (he turns his head rapidly to see what it was). Either this bullet or part of #3 then sent a chip of concrete into the face of an onlooker down the street.
Oswald's second bullet passed through Kennedy and Connally, lodging in his leg until it came out and was found at the hospital. This bullet was referred to as "magic", as the crude forensics of the day kept people from realizing it traveled in an almost straight line, being slowed by passing through soft tissue and so sustaining minimal injury to itself.
Oswald's third bullet struck Kennedy at between Zapruder frame 312 and Zapruder frame 313. This knocked his head forward and down about 3" in 1/18th of a second. The right side of his skull then sprayed forwards and to the right, mostly, causing his head to be forced back and to the left. This bullet left a clear entry wound or "bevel", in the rear of his skull, proving beyond doubt it came from the rear. This bullet fragmented and bits were found in the car. Part of it may have cleared the windshield, and as I mentioned, slightly wounded an onlooker.
Some like to pretend that this final shot came from the Grassy Knoll, from Kennedy's front right, but no bullet came out the left side of his skull. In any case, there was a concrete wall between the suspected sniper's nest, and JFK, at the moment the third shot was fired, so it it simply not possible for this to be correct.
